2021 Burgundy harvest reports | Côte de Beaune
Domaine Rémi Jobard – Meursault Remi Jobard told us:- ‘It was the shortest harvest ever – even my father had never seen anything like it. 1/3 of the normal harvest, and short in red as well as white. I picked late – starting as most people finished. It seemed that they wanted to make reasons […]

2021 Burgundy harvest reports | Côte de Nuits
An interesting report given that there seems to be a ‘blanket’ view that 2021 is a disaster in France. In Burgundy the quantity of white is certainly disastrously low, but there will as usual be some nicer surprises.
